| FORM 990, PART VI, SECTION B, LINE 12C | ANY DIRECTOR, OFFICER, OR KEY EMPLOYEE OF CONCORDE FIRE SOCCER ASSOCIATION, INC., WHO HAS AN INTEREST IN A CONTRACT OR OTHER TRANSACTION PRESENTED TO THE BOARD OR A COMMITTEE THEREOF FOR AUTHORIZATION, APPROVAL, OR RATIFICATION, SHALL MAKE A PROMPT AND FULL DISCLOSURE OF HIS/HER INTEREST TO THE BOARD OR COMMITTEE PRIOR TO ACTING ON SUCH CONTRACT OR TRANSACTION. SUCH DISCLOSURE SHALL INCLUDE ANY RELEVANT AND MATERIAL FACTS KNOWN TO SUCH PERSON ABOUT THE CONTRACT OR TRANSACTION WHICH MIGHT REASONABLY BE ADVERSE TO THE CORPORATION'S INTEREST. THE BODY TO WHICH SUCH DISCLOSURE IS MADE SHALL THEREUPON DETERMINE BY A VOTE OF SEVENTY-FIVE PERCENT (75%)OF THE BOARD MEMBERS ENTITLED TO VOTE, WHETHER THE DISCLOSURE SHOWS THAT A CONFLICT OF INTEREST EXISTS OR CAN REASONABLY BE CONSTRUED TO EXIST. IF A CONFLICT OF INTEREST IS DEEMED TO EXIST, SUCH PERSON SHALL NOT VOTE ON, NOR USE HIS OR HER PERSONAL INFLUENCE ON, NOR PARTICIPATE (OTHER THAN TO PRESENT FACTUAL INFORMATION, OR RESPOND TO QUESTIONS) IN THE DISCUSSIONS OR DELIBERATIONS WITH RESPECT TO SUCH CONTRACT OR TRANSACTION. SUCH PERSON MAY BE COUNTED IN DETERMINING WHETHER A QUORUM IS PRESENT BUT MAY NOT BE COUNTED WHEN THE BOARD OR COMMITTEE OF THE BOARD TAKES ACTION ON THE TRANSACTION. THE MINUTES OF THE MEETING SHALL REFLECT THE DISCLOSURE MADE, THE VOTE THEREON, THE ABSTENTION FROM VOTING AND PARTICIPATION, AND WHETHER A QUORUM WAS PRESENT. A REVIEW OF ANY CONFLICT OF INTEREST OCCURS AT EACH BOARD MEETING. THERE HAVE BEEN NO MATERIAL CONFLICTS DURING THESE PERIODS OF TIME. |
| FORM 990, PART VI, SECTION B, LINE 15 | THE PRESIDENT, VICE PRESIDENT AND TREASURER FORM THE COMPENSATION COMMITTEE. THEY GATHER COMPARABLE DATA THEN DETERMINE COMPENSATION FOR THE EXECUTIVE DIRECTOR AND OTHER TOP SALARIED PERSONS INCLUDING A REVIEW AND APPROVAL OF COMPARABLE DATA FROM OTHER SOCCER PROGRAMS FOR EXECUTIVE DIRECTOR, DIRECTOR OF COACHING OR OTHER PROGRAM DIRECTORS THAT ARE FUNCTIONALLY COMPARABLE IN POSITIONS AT SIMILARLY SITUATED ORGANIZATIONS. THIS COMPARISON INCLUDES BASE SALARY, BONUSES AND EMPLOYER PROVIDED HEALTH BENEFITS FROM WHICH ALL THE COMPENSATION FACTORS ARE CONSIDERED. THE COMPENSATION RECOMMENDED AND AGREED UPON BY THE COMPENSATION COMMITTEE THEN DOCUMENTED IN AN ADDENDUM TO THE EMPLOYMENT AGREEMENT AND EXECUTED BY THE EMPLOYEE, THE PRESIDENT, VICE PRESIDENT AND THE TREASURER. EXCEPT FOR THE EXECUTIVE DIRECTOR, NO OFFICERS ARE GIVEN COMPENSATION. THERE ARE NO OTHER KEY EMPLOYEES OTHER THAN THE EXECUTIVE DIRECTOR DESCRIBED ABOVE. |
